IPL batting records reflect the tournament's evolution from competitive league to global cricketing spectacle. Virat Kohli leads the all-time run charts with over 8,000 runs, a milestone that cements his status as the IPL's greatest accumulator. This guide ranks every significant IPL run scorer.

Among batters with 3,000+ IPL runs, AB de Villiers holds the highest strike rate at 151.68, reflecting his extraordinary ability to accelerate at any stage of an innings. Andre Russell's strike rate of 177+ (with 2,000+ runs) is the highest among players with significant run totals. Modern IPL batting demands strike rates above 140 to be considered elite.

Kohli's 973 runs in IPL 2016 remains the single-season record, including four centuries and seven fifties. Warner's 848 runs in 2016 is second. The average runs-per-season for top scorers has increased from 500 in early seasons to 600+ in recent editions, reflecting expanded fixtures and evolved batting techniques.

Kohli's entire IPL career with Royal Challengers Bangalore contrasts with David Warner's stints at Delhi, Hyderabad, and Delhi again. Franchise loyalty has significant statistical implications — Kohli's familiarity with Chinnaswamy Stadium's conditions contributed to his home record of averaging 40+ with a strike rate of 138.
